Sumario:Penile cancer is rare and most frequently affects older men. We report the case of a male patient with a history of tuberculosis and also suffering from diabetes mellitus (DM), who presented squamous cell penile cancer and underwent satisfactory surgical treatment. The purpose of the article is to show the possible relationship between diabetes and penile cancer, being this an infrequent neoplasm in the area. However, it is advisable to keep it in mind in order to make an early diagnosis and timely treatment.
